Step back in time to the roaring twenties with this enchanting Art Deco illustration by Anne Harriet Fish, titled 'Fish: A Coy Drinker.' Dated 1927, this image showcases the essence of the era's fashionable and flirtatious spirit. The illustration features a charming young flapper, dressed in the height of twenties fashion. She dons a short, shimmering dress adorned with intricate beadwork and a chic cloche hat, accessorized with a long string of pearls. Her coy expression and playful pose exude an air of sophistication and mystery, as she sips on a cocktail glass filled with a vibrant, red elixir. The background of the illustration is a stunning Art Deco design, with geometric shapes and bold lines that reflect the style of the era. The overall effect is one of glamour, charm, and a touch of mischief. Anne Harriet Fish was a renowned illustrator of her time, known for her ability to capture the essence of the era in her work. This illustration, in particular, is a testament to her talent and her keen understanding of the fashion and society of the 1920s.
